蟒穴

首页 > 睡眠良方 / 正文

华为apk如何签名

2025-04-23 睡眠良方

华为ak签名,是确保应用安全性和可靠性的重要步骤。以下,我将详细介绍如何为华为ak进行签名,帮助您轻松解决这一实际问题。

一、了解ak签名的重要性

1.ak签名可以保证应用的完整性和安全性,防止应用被篡改。

2.签名后的ak可以被华为设备识别,确保应用能够在设备上正常运行。

二、准备签名工具

1.获取JDK:下载并安装Java开发工具包(JDK)。

2.获取签名工具:下载并安装签名工具,如JDK自带的keytool。

三、生成密钥对

1.打开命令行工具。

2.执行keytool-genkey-aliasmykey-keyalgRSA-keysize2048-keystoremykeystore-validity10000。

3.根据提示输入密钥信息,包括别名、密码、有效期等。

四、签名ak

1.打开命令行工具。

2.执行jarsigner-verose-keystoremykeystore-storeassmyassword-keyaliasmykey-signedjarsigned.akmya-deug.akmykey。

3.将mya-deug.ak替换为您的ak文件名,signed.ak为签名后的文件名。

五、验证签名

1.使用签名工具验证签名是否成功。

2.执行jarsigner-verify-verose-certssigned.ak。

3.若无错误提示,表示签名成功。

六、发布签名ak

1.将签名后的ak上传到华为开发者平台。

2.按照平台要求填写相关信息,提交审核。

七、注意事项

1.确保密钥信息安全,避免泄露。

2.使用不同的密钥对同一应用进行签名,可能导致应用无法正常运行。

3.签名后的ak不能随意修改,否则将导致签名失效。

通过以上步骤,您可以为华为ak进行签名,确保应用的安全性和可靠性。希望**能帮助到您,如有疑问,请随时提问。祝您在华为开发者道路上一切顺利!

网站分类